]> git.immae.eu Git - github/fretlink/time-picker.git/blobdiff - README.md
Readme file was updated to reflect show12Hours option
[github/fretlink/time-picker.git] / README.md
index 60e5ab035cfb610e8dd581304700b3e5fa3439a1..b9d06fda604552a47a619592da0bce85a3c2eba4 100644 (file)
--- a/README.md
+++ b/README.md
@@ -39,7 +39,6 @@ Usage
 
 ```
 import TimePicker from 'rc-time-picker';
-import React from 'react';
 import ReactDOM from 'react-dom';
 ReactDOM.render(<TimePicker />, container);
 ```
@@ -49,25 +48,48 @@ API
 
 ### TimePicker
 
-| Name           | Type                       | Default                                       | Description                                                                                |
-|----------------|----------------------------|-----------------------------------------------|--------------------------------------------------------------------------------------------|
-| prefixCls      | String                     |                                               | prefixCls of this component                                                                |
-| locale         | Object                     | import from 'rc-time-picker/lib/locale/en_US' |                                                                                            |
-| disabled       | Boolean                    | false                                         | whether picker is disabled                                                                 |
-| open           | Boolean                    | false                                         | current open state of picker. controlled prop                                              |
-| defaultValue   | GregorianCalendar          | null                                          | default initial value                                                                      |
-| value          | GregorianCalendar                 | null                                          | current value                                                                              |
-| gregorianCalendarLocale   | GregorianCalendar  locale object               | null                                          | if value and defaultValue not set, you should set this to your locale                                                                            |
-| placeholder    | String                     | ''                                            | time input's placeholder                                                                   |
-| showHour       | Boolean                    | whether show hour                             |                                                                                            |
-| showSecond     | Boolean                    | whether show second                           |                                                                                            |
-| formatter      | String|GregorianCalendarFormatter |                                        |                                                                                            |
-| hourOptions    | Array<Number>              | hour options                                  |                                                                                            |
-| minuteOptions  | Array<Number>              | minute options                                |                                                                                            |
-| secondOptions  | Array<Number>              | second options                                |                                                                                            |
-| onChange       | Function                   | null                                          | called when select a different value                                                       |
-| placement      | String                     | bottomLeft                                    | one of ['left','right','top','bottom', 'topLeft', 'topRight', 'bottomLeft', 'bottomRight'] |
-| transitionName | String                     | ''                                            |                                                                                            |
+| Name                    | Type                              | Default                                       | Description                                                                                |
+|-------------------------|-----------------------------------|-----------------------------------------------|--------------------------------------------------------------------------------------------|
+| prefixCls               | String                            |                                               | prefixCls of this component                                                                |
+| clearText               | String                            | 'clear'                                       |                                                                                            |
+| disabled                | Boolean                           | false                                         | whether picker is disabled                                                                 |
+| clearText               | String                            | clear                                         | clear text                                                                                 |
+| open                    | Boolean                           | false                                         | current open state of picker. controlled prop                                              |
+| defaultValue            | moment                            | null                                          | default initial value                                                                      |
+| defaultOpenValue        | moment                            | moment()                                      | default open panel value, used to set utcOffset,locale if value/defaultValue absent        |
+| value                   | moment                            | null                                          | current value                                                                              |
+| placeholder             | String                            | ''                                            | time input's placeholder                                                                   |
+| showHour                | Boolean                           | whether show hour                             |                                                                                            |
+| showMinute                | Boolean                         | whether show minute                             |                                                                                            |
+| showSecond              | Boolean                           | whether show second                           |                                                                                            |
+| format                  | String                            |                                               |                                                                                            |
+| disabledHours           | Function                          | disabled hour options                         |                                                                                            |
+| disabledMinutes         | Function                          | disabled minute options                       |                                                                                            |
+| disabledSeconds         | Function                          | disabled second options                       |                                                                                            |
+| show12Hours             | Boolean                           | 12 hours display mode                         |                                                                                            |
+| hideDisabledOptions     | Boolean                           | whether hide disabled options                 |                                                                                            |
+| onChange                | Function                          | null                                          | called when select a different value                                                       |
+| addon                   | Function                          | nothing                                       | called from timepicker panel to render some addon to its bottom, like an OK button. Receives panel instance as parameter, to be able to close it like `panel.close()`.|
+| placement               | String                            | bottomLeft                                    | one of ['left','right','top','bottom', 'topLeft', 'topRight', 'bottomLeft', 'bottomRight'] |
+| transitionName          | String                            | ''                                            |                                                                                            |
+| name                    | String                            | - | sets the name of the generated input |
+| onOpen                  | Function({ open })                |   | when TimePicker panel is opened      |
+| onClose                 | Function({ open })                |   | when TimePicker panel is opened      |
+
+## Test Case
+
+```
+npm test
+npm run chrome-test
+```
+
+## Coverage
+
+```
+npm run coverage
+```
+
+open coverage/ dir
 
 License
 -------